Comprehending Clinical Psychology
Clinical psychology is a branch of psychology that focuses on the assessment, diagnosis, and treatment of mental, emotional, and behavioral disorders. Clinical psychologists utilize a variety of healing strategies and interventions to assist people enhance their mental health and lifestyle. They operate in numerous settings, including private practices, medical facilities, schools, and community health centers.
The Role of a Clinical Psychologist
A clinical psychologist's function is multifaceted and can include:
- Assessment and Diagnosis: Conducting psychological evaluations to detect mental health conditions.
- Therapy: Providing individual, group, or household therapy to address a large variety of issues, such as stress and anxiety, anxiety, trauma, and relationship problems.
- Research: Engaging in research study to advance the understanding of mental health and develop new treatment methods.
- Assessment: Working with other health care specialists to supply thorough care.
- Prevention: Developing and carrying out programs to avoid mental health issues.

What to Expect in Your First Session
Your very first session with a clinical psychologist is usually a preliminary consultation. Throughout this session, you can expect the following:
- Intake Interview: The psychologist will ask you about your background, present symptoms, and any previous mental health treatment.
- Assessment: You may be asked to complete surveys or take part in assessments to assist the psychologist understand your specific requirements.
- Treatment Plan: Based on the assessment, the psychologist will go over prospective treatment alternatives and establish a strategy customized to your goals.

FAQs
Q: What is the difference in between a clinical psychologist and a psychiatrist?
- A clinical psychologist is a mental health expert with a postgraduate degree in psychology. They concentrate on assessment, diagnosis, and therapy. A psychiatrist is a medical physician who can prescribe medication and also provides therapy.
Q: How long does therapy usually last?
- The duration of therapy differs depending on the specific and the nature of the concerns being attended to. Some individuals may see substantial improvement in a couple of sessions, while others might need ongoing therapy for several months or years.
Q: Can I see a clinical psychologist without a recommendation?
- Yes, lots of clinical psychologists accept self-referrals. Nevertheless, if you plan to use insurance coverage, a referral from a medical care doctor might be needed.
Q: What if I don't feel comfortable with my psychologist?
- It's essential to feel comfortable and comprehended by your therapist. If you do not feel a great connection, it's fine to look for another psychologist. Therapy is a collective process, and finding the ideal fit is essential.
